Recommended Local Camping and Attractions

  • Cedar Ridge Campground on Lake Belton

    This campground on the North side of Lake Belton operated by the Corp of Engineers is one of my favorite and one of the most popular campgrounds. Includes a Boat Ramp, 76 shady campsites including screened cabins and the very popular group site “Turkey Roost”

  • Live Oak Campground on Lake Belton

    This is a very nice campground operated by the Corp of Engineers is on Lake Belton near the dam, a little close to restaurants and great hiking right across the road at Miller Springs. 48 shady campsites and a boat ramp.

  • West Cliff Campground on Lake Belton

    This campground on the South shore of Lake Belton is operated by Corp of Engineers. Spots are close to the lake and over great views and a swimming beach. 31 campsites and a boat ramp.

  • White Flint Campground on Lake Belton

    This campground is on the far North headwaters of Lake Belton. The campsites and screened shelters, and boat ramp tend to be less busy then some of the other Lake Belton Parks.

  • Stillhouse Lake Campgrounds

    Stillhouse Lake is a twin to Lake Belton just 10 miles to the south. This is also a popular fishing and recreational lake. There are two Corp of Engineers campgrounds located on Stillhouse Lake Dana Peak on the south shore, and Union Grove on the north shore
